National city placement
According to ACS 5-Year Estimates, Edelstein, IL sits among US cities with a top-decile household income, on a village-scale population base, across a single-ZIP footprint.

High-income footprint on only 1 ZIP: the city page and the ZIP page nearly coincide. Headline income $118,393 and home value $262,100 should be read as near-neighborhood numbers ; bachelor's attainment averages 49.0%.
Owner-occupancy here runs high (94.2%) - tenure is stable enough that the ZIP detail's owner share is the right next click, not a renter-heavy compare.

These ZIP codes sit in Peoria County, which covers 25 ZIP codes in all; 1 of them fall in Edelstein. See the Peoria County roll-up →
Edelstein sits in the upper half of Peoria County on income: Peoria, Chillicothe and Peoria Heights report less, while Dunlap and Edwards report more. Peoria marks the far end of that range at $51,955, 56% below Edelstein.
